HomeMy WebLinkAboutOrdinances_2444_CCv0001.pdf ORDINANCE NO. 2444 A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Y OF REDLANDS ADOPTING AMENDMENT NO. 14 TO SPECIFIC PLAN NO. 40 AND AMENDING ORDINANCES NOS. 2432, 2364, 2322, 2321 AND 2320 WHEREAS, the Planning Commission of the City of Redlands has reviewed Amendment No. 14 to Specific Plan No. 40 after holding a public hearing upon such notice in accordance with the Government Code of the State of California; and WHEREAS, on the 18th day of July, 2000, the City Council held a duly-noticed public hearing concerned with the proposed specific plan amendment; and WHEREAS, a mitigation measure monitoring program has been adopted to ensure compliance during project implementation; and WHEREAS, all of the provisions of the Government Code relating to the adoption of a specific plan have been complied with; NOW, THEREFORE, TH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F REDLANDS DOES ORDAIN as follows: SECTION ONE: That Amendment No. 14 to Specific Plan No. 40 shall be adopted by addition of the following: "Section EV3.1413 Conditionally Permitted Uses The following uses may be permitted subject to approval of a Conditional Use Permit by the Planning Commission. Determinations regarding similar uses not specifically listed shall be made pursuant to Section EV3.0135(b): (1) Recycling operations for rock, sand,gravel, and waste concrete and asphalt." SECTION TWO: The Mayor shall sign this ordinance and the City Clerk shall certify to the adoption of this ordinance and shall cause it, or a summary of it, to be published once in the Redlands Daily Facts, a newspaper of general circulation within the City, and thereafter, this ordinance shall take effect in accordance with law.
